A mass of 1.23 kg is attached to an ideal spring with a spring constant of 235 N/m and set into oscillations with an amplitude of 0.08 m. What distance from equilibrium is the mass when its speed is 0.387 m/s? Just enter  a number rounded to 3 significant figures. Assume proper SI Units.
